How to Choose a Sportsbook

A sportsbook is a type of gambling establishment that takes bets on various sporting events. They are usually legal companies that operate with a license. They also provide odds and payout formulas so gamblers can calculate potential winnings. In addition, some sportsbooks offer a payout bonus for betting on certain teams or games. In the US, more than 20 states have legalised sportsbooks.

Unlike casinos, where you have to be lucky to win, sportsbooks make money by setting odds that guarantee a profit in the long run. They do this by reserving a percentage of the bets that they take, known as the juice or vig. If you want to be a successful sports bettor, you must have an understanding of the sport and be able to read the odds.

When looking for a sportsbook, you should look for one that offers the odds and lines that you are interested in. This will help you find the best value. It is also a good idea to shop around for the best odds and lines, because you may be able to get better value by placing a bet at another sportsbook.
